Yes. For more information, see the Ask the Directory Services Team blog. DFS Replication does not communicate with File Replication Service (FRS). You want to force the non-authoritative synchronization of sysvol replication on a domain controller (DC). Don't configure file system policies on replicated folders. 2 Paradoxically, these old commands leaves servers in a non-recommended state. DFSRDIAG POLLAD You'll see Event ID 4614 and 4604 in the DFSR event log indicating sysvol replication has been initialized. If the local path of the replicated folder on the destination server(s) is also a volume root, no further changes are made to the folder attributes. It led to a charter for our Windows PowerShell design process: 1. Files are also staged on the receiving member as they are transferred if they are less than 64 KB in size, although you can configure this setting between 16 KB and 1 MB. The DFS Replication service is stopping communication with partner DC1 for replication group Domain System Volume due to an error. This can cause DFS Replication to continually retry replicating the files, causing holes in the version vector and possible performance problems. * You can optionally disable cross-file RDC on Windows Server2012R2. Unlike custom DFSR replicated folders, sysvol replication is intentionally protected from any editing through its management interfaces to prevent accidents. We then devoted ourselves to this, sometimes arguing late into the night about a PowerShell experience that you would actually want to use. After this errors there's only informational events telling everything is running smoothly. To remove DFSR memberships in a supported and recommended fashion, see note 2 above. To migrate replication of the SYSVOL folder to DFS Replication, see Migrate SYSVOL replication to DFS Replication. For information about Backup and Recovery functionality in Windows Server2008R2 and Windows Server2008, see Backup and Recovery. For instance, if youre troubleshooting with Microsoft Support and they say, I want you to turn up the DFSR debug logging verbosity and number of logs on all your servers, you can now do this with a single easy command: Or what if I just set up replication and accidentally chose the empty folder as the primary copy, resulting in all my files moving into the hidden PreExisting folder, I can now easily move them back: Dang, that hauls tail! More info about Internet Explorer and Microsoft Edge, DFS Namespaces: Frequently Asked Questions, DFS Namespaces and DFS Replication Overview, Changes in Functionality from Windows Server 2008 to Windows Server 2008 R2, Changes in Functionality from Windows Server 2003 with SP1 to Windows Server 2008, Migrate SYSVOL replication to DFS Replication, FRS2DFSR An FRS to DFSR Migration Utility, https://go.microsoft.com/fwlink/?LinkID=195437, https://go.microsoft.com/fwlink/?LinkId=182261, Add a Failover Cluster to a Replication Group, https://go.microsoft.com/fwlink/?LinkId=155085, Testing Antivirus Application Interoperability with DFS Replication, https://go.microsoft.com/fwlink/?LinkId=73990, https://go.microsoft.com/fwlink/?LinkId=73991, https://go.microsoft.com/fwlink/?LinkId=125363, Delegate the Ability to Manage DFS Replication, https://go.microsoft.com/fwlink/?LinkId=182294, Microsoft's Support Statement Around Replicated User Profile Data, https://go.microsoft.com/fwlink/?LinkId=201282, DFS Replication Initial Sync in Windows Server 2012 R2: Attack of the Clones, https://go.microsoft.com/fwlink/?LinkId=75043, https://go.microsoft.com/fwlink/?LinkId=182264, Automating DFS Replication Health Reports, https://go.microsoft.com/fwlink/?LinkId=74010, DFS Replication Management Pack for System Center Operations Manager 2007, https://go.microsoft.com/fwlink/?LinkId=182265, Remote Server Administration Tools for Windows 7, Remote Server Administration Tools for Windows 8, Distributed File System Replication Cmdlets in Windows PowerShell, https://go.microsoft.com/fwlink/?LinkId=182268, https://go.microsoft.com/fwlink/?LinkId=182269, Make a Replicated Folder Read-Only on a Particular Member, https://go.microsoft.com/fwlink/?LinkId=156740. Learn more from " Setting Up DFS-based File Replcation ." replication group that you want to create a diagnostic report for, and then. Screened files must not exist in any replicated folder before screening is enabled. Q. Forcing DFS Replication (DFSR) Members to Replicate? Windows SharePoint Services provides tight coherency in the form of file check-out functionality that DFS Replication doesn't. For more information, see SetFileAttributes Function in the MSDN library (https://go.microsoft.com/fwlink/?LinkId=182269). To manage DFS Replication from other versions of Windows, use Remote Desktop or the Remote Server Administration Tools for Windows 7. That domain controller has now done an authoritative sync of SYSVOL. 2. Hi folks, Ned here again. Run the DFSRADMIN.EXE command-line tool N times, or run N arguments as part of the BULK command-line option. State 0 means that all DCs are . To force DFSR to replicate Sysvol it would be Text dfsrdiag pollad For regular replicated shares it would be Text dfsrdiag syncnow /partner:DFSRPARTNER /RGName:REPLICATEDFOLDER1 /Time:1 I will note that this command only does something if its not a replication time. 3. This posting is provided AS IS with no warranties or guarantees , and confers no rights. Set the DFS Replication service Startup Type to Manual, and stop the service on all domain controllers in the domain. For more information about how to specify the RPC Endpoint Mapper, see article154596 in the Microsoft Knowledge Base (https://go.microsoft.com/fwlink/?LinkId=73991).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. dfsrdiag.exe | DFS Replication Diagnostics Tool | STRONTIC However, when hosting multiple applications or server roles on a single server, it is important that you test this configuration before implementing it in a production environment. Lets start with the simple case of creating a replication topology with two servers that will be used to synchronize a single folder. You can force replication immediately by using DFS Management, as described in Edit Replication Schedules. Yes. If remote differential compression (RDC) is enabled on the connection, inbound replication of a file larger than 64KB that began replicating immediately prior to the schedule closing (or changing to No bandwidth) continues when the schedule opens (or changes to something other than No bandwidth). You can configure DFS Replication to use a limited amount of bandwidth on a per-connection basis (bandwidth throttling). exactly how to write your very own DFSR scripts. Its not all AD here, by the way we greatly extended the ease of operations without the need for WMIC.EXE, DFSRDIAG.EXE, etc. Windows Server 2012 and 2008 R2 dfsrdiag 1 dfsrdiag syncnow /RGName:"Domain System Volume" /Partner:OTHER_DC /Time:15 /v PowerShell 1 Sync-DfsReplicationGroup -GroupName "Domain System Volume" -SourceComputerName "AD-01" -DestinationComputerName "AD-02" -DurationInMinutes 15 No. We do not support creating a one-way replication connection with DFS Replication in Windows Server2008 or Windows Server2003R2. 2. No. If two schedules are opened, updates are generally received and installed from both connections at the same time. This is old stuff, first set up years ago when bandwidth was low and latency high. Yesassuming that there's a private Wide Area Network (WAN) link (not the Internet) connecting the branch offices. DFS Replication and DFS Namespaces can be used separately or together. entry to clarify how DFS Replication handles hard links. Local time means the time of the member hosting the inbound connection. This prevents DFS Replication from replicating these files until they are closed. You'll see Event ID 4114 in the DFSR event log indicating sysvol replication is no longer being replicated on each of them. Restore-DfsrPreservedFiles is so cool that it rates its own blog post (coming soon). For more information, Testing Antivirus Application Interoperability with DFS Replication (https://go.microsoft.com/fwlink/?LinkId=73990). Because connections and replication group updates are not serialized, there is no specific order in which updates are received. For more information, see Add a Failover Cluster to a Replication Group (https://go.microsoft.com/fwlink/?LinkId=155085). DFSR Troubleshooting Microsoft Taste Error: 1722 (The RPC server is unavailable.) Changes to these attribute values trigger replication of the attributes. DFS Replication won't replicate files or folders that are encrypted using the Encrypting File System (EFS). DFS Replication can safely replicate Microsoft Outlook personal folder files (.pst) and Microsoft Access files only if they are stored for archival purposes and are not accessed across the network by using a client such as Outlook or Access (to open .pst or Access files, first copy the files to a local storage device). Update May 2014: See it all in video! No. Windows Server 2012 R2 introduced these capabilities for the first time as in-box options via Windows PowerShell. Added the Does DFS Replication continue staging files when replication is disabled by a schedule or bandwidth throttling quota, or when a connection is manually disabled? Files are staged on the sending member when the receiving member requests the file (unless the file is 64 KB or smaller) as shown in the following table. Propagation test completes in few minutes from DC2 => DC1 but not in opposite direction. To use cross-file RDC, one member of the replication connection must be running an edition of the Windows operating system that supports cross-file RDC. DFS Replication can replicate numerous folders between servers. Applies to: Windows Server 2012 R2 Servers running Windows Server 2003 R2 don't support using DFS Replication to replicate the SYSVOL folder. Check this log on both domain controllers. Files with the IO_REPARSE_TAG_DEDUP, IO_REPARSE_TAG_SIS, or IO_REPARSE_TAG_HSM reparse tags are replicated as normal files. Force DFS Replication/Force DFSR Members to Replicate on windows server Yes. RDC can use an older version of a file with the same name in the replicated folder or in the DfsrPrivate\ConflictandDeleted folder (located under the local path of the replicated folder). How to force DFSR SYSVOL replication - Windows Server 2012 and 2008 R2 f you are using DFS-R service for SYSVOL replication, You can use " dfsrdiag SyncNow " Example: dfsrdiag syncnow /RGName:"Domain System Volume" /Partner:OTHER_DC /Time:15 /v dfsrdiag backlog /rgname:"Domain System Volume" /rfname:"SYSVOL Share" /smem:DC1 /rmem:DC2 DFS Replication Troubleshooting | Niktips's Blog This can result in sharing violations because an open file isn't replicated until the file is closed. Force authoritative and non-authoritative synchronization for DFSR However, it does attempt to preserve the older version of the file in the hidden DfsrPrivate\ConflictandDeleted folder on the computer where the conflict was detected. These included the options to configure debug logging on or off, maximum debug log files, debug log verbosity, maximum debug log messages, dirty shutdown autorecovery behavior, staging folder high and low watermarks, conflict folder high and low watermarks, and purging the ConflictAndDeleted folder. Windows SharePoint Services2.0 with Service Pack2 is available as part of Windows Server2003R2. Computer: DC2.edu.vantaa.fi Files may be replicated out of order. However, DFS Replication does replicate folders used by non-Microsoft applications, which might cause the applications to fail on the destination server(s) if the applications have interoperability issues with DFS Replication. Yes. DFS Replication replicates volumes on which Single Instance Storage (SIS) is enabled. Only the part of the file associated with the Access Control List (ACL) is replicated, although DFS Replication must still read the entire file into the staging area. If small changes are made to existing files, DFS Replication with Remote Differential Compression (RDC) will provide a much higher performance than copying the file directly. Dfs TechEd North America 2014 with live demos and walkthroughs: Its the age of Windows PowerShell, folks. That domain controller has now done a D2 of sysvol replication. Nave approaches like For example, on server A, you can connect to a replication group defined in the forest with servers A and B as members. Disabling RDC can reduce CPU utilization and replication latency on fast local area network (LAN) links that have no bandwidth constraints or for replication groups that consist primarily of files smaller than 64KB. DFS Replication is much faster than FRS, particularly when small changes are made to large files and RDC is enabled. entry to add discussion of ReFS. The DFS Replication service uses remote procedure calls (RPC) over TCP to replicate data. Checking domain controller configuration DFS Configuration You can force polling by using the Update-DfsrConfigurationFromAD cmdlet, or the Dfsrdiag PollAD command. Yes. For information about what's new in DFS Replication, see the following topics: DFS Namespaces and DFS Replication Overview (in Windows Server 2012), What's New in Distributed File System topic in Changes in Functionality from Windows Server 2008 to Windows Server 2008 R2, Distributed File System topic in Changes in Functionality from Windows Server 2003 with SP1 to Windows Server 2008. However, this is only a schedule override, and it does not force replication of unchanged or identical files. This can fix an issue where your group policy objects are. Edited the What are the supported limits of DFS Replication? Yes. If setting the authoritative flag on one DC, you must non-authoritatively synchronize DFS Replication sets the System and Hidden attributes on the replicated folder on the destination server(s). Yes. Try our Virtual Agent - It can help you quickly identify and fix common File replication issues. This is useful for users who travel between two branch offices and want to be able to access their files at either branch or while offline. When a conflict occurs, DFS Replication logs an informational event to the DFS Replication event log. During initial replication, the primary member's files will always take precedence in the conflict resolution that occurs if the receiving members have different versions of files on the primary member. If Remote Differential Compression (RDC) is disabled on the connection, the file is staged unless it is 256KB or smaller. If you choose to disable RDC on a connection, test the replication efficiency before and after the change to verify that you have improved replication performance. The replication group schedule may be set to Universal Time Coordinate (UTC) while the connection schedule is set to the local time of the receiving member. I spent many years in the field before I came to Redmond and Ive felt this pain. Yes. DFS Replication overcomes three common FRS issues: Journal wraps: DFS Replication recovers from journal wraps on the fly. If changed files have not been replicated, DFS Replication will automatically replicate them when configured to do so. This can delay when the file is available on the receiving member. Yes. The operation completed successfully. Then set all the replication group schedules to full bandwidth, open 24 hours a day, 7 days a week. Its as simple as this: Done! Doing so can cause DFS Replication to move conflicting copies of the files to the hidden DfsrPrivate\ConflictandDeleted folder. How to perform an authoritative synchronization of DFSR-replicated sysvol replication (like D4 for FRS) There is no longer a limit to the number of replication groups, replicated folders, connections, or replication group members. Because this process relies on various buffers in lower levels of the network stack, including RPC, the replication traffic tends to travel in bursts which may at times saturate the network links. However, you must be a domain administrator or local administrator of the affected file servers to make changes to the DFS Replication configuration. The set of signatures is transferred from server to client. entry to increase the tested number of replicated files on a volume. For a list of editions that support cross-file RDC, see Which editions of the Windows operating system support cross-file RDC? If this happens, use the Dfsradmin membership /set /isprimary:true command on the primary member server to restore the primary member designation manually. Distributed File System Replication (DFS-R or DFSR) is a native replication service in Windows that organizations can use to replicate folders across file servers in distributed locations. When DFS Replication detects a conflict, it uses the version of the file that was saved last. 1.Logon to TMDC01 as Administrator. The service will retry the connection periodically. Now I finally have brand new modern circuits to all my branch offices and the need for weird schedules is past. 100 read-only servers added in a hub and spoke, using four commands, a text file, and some variables and aliases used to save my poor little nubbin fingers. Scripts can use WMI to collect backlog informationmanually or through MOM. If you are using Windows Server2008 or Windows Server2003 R2, you can simulate a one-way connection by performing the following actions: Train administrators to make changes only on the server(s) that you want to designate as primary servers. dfsrdiag syncnow /partner:RedMon-FS01 /RGName:"RedMon-FS01 - RedMon-FS02" /Time:1 DFSRDIAG POLLAD /MEM:%computername% Last update DC name WMIC /namespace:\\root\mic rosoftdfs path DfsrReplicationGroupConfig get LastChangeSource Test the Namespace servers DFSDiag /TestDFSConfig /DFSRoot:\\Contoso\Apac$ Checking domain controller configuration Disable DFSR Sysvol replication on problematic ADC; Then you should initiate DFSR Sysvol non-authoritative restore on that ADC; Steps to perform a non-authoritative restore of DFSR SYSVOL (like "D2" for FRS) Step 1. DFSRDIAG POLLAD Wait a few minutes you will see Event ID 4602 in the DFSR event log (Open up event viewer and navigate to Applications and Services Logs -> DFS Replication) indicating SYSVOL has been initialized. Lets scale this up - maybe I want to create a 100 server, read-only, hub-and-spoke configuration for distributing software. Its not surprising if youre wary. To get the meaningful data from the GUID use: This size threshold is 64KB by default. To use cross-file RDC, one member of the replication connection must be running an edition of Windows that supports cross-file RDC. However, RDC works more efficiently on certain file types such as Word docs, PST files, and VHD images. DFS Replication does not replicate the FILE_ATTRIBUTE_TEMPORARY value. First published on TECHNET on Aug 20, 2013. However, DFS Replication does require that the server clocks match closely. DFS Replication doesn't support replicating files on Cluster Shared Volumes. To recover lost files, restore the files from the file system folder or shared folder using File History, the Restore previous versions command in File Explorer, or by restoring the files from backup. Weve been beating the Windows PowerShell drum for years now, but sometimes, new cmdlets dont offer better ways to do things, only different ways. You can replicate sparse files. Otherwise you will see conflicts on DCs, originating from any DCs where you did not set auth/non-auth and restarted the DFSR service. Now: I just added the hub and spoke connections here with a pair of commands instead of four, as the PowerShell creates bi-directionally by default instead of one-way only.
Marilyn Webb Obituary, Frankfort Funeral Home, Nycfc Academy Contact, Articles D